java的前台传来一个Date日期的值,获取该日期的前一天
最简单的做法是: // 假如这是前台传来的Date时间 Date dt; // 1天的毫秒数 long oneDayTime = 1000*3600*24; // 这个now就是减1天的时间了 Date nowTime = new Date(dt.getTime() - oneDayTime); 原理就是用Date的毫秒数做运算,最后再将运算出来的毫秒数再转换成时间。
最简单的做法是: // 假如这是前台传来的Date时间 Date dt; // 1天的毫秒数 long oneDayTime = 1000*3600*24; // 这个now就是减1天的时间了 Date nowTime = new Date(dt.getTime() - oneDayTime); 原理就是用Date的毫秒数做运算,最后再将运算出来的毫秒数再转换成时间。